Zusammenfassung:A direct and unified approach is used to analyze the efficiency of batched searching of sequential and tree-structured files. The analysis is applicable to arbitrary search distributions, and closed-form expressions are obtained for the expected batched searching cost and savings. In particular, we consider a search distribution satisfying Zipf's law for sequential files and four types of uniform (random) search distribution for sequential and tree-structured files. These results unify and extend earlier research on batched searching and estimating block accesses for database systems.
